Phoenicia, Tyre. Silver 1/2 Shekel (7.01 g), ca. 126/5 BC-AD 65/6. CY 43 (84/3 BC). Laureate bust of Melkart right, lion's skin tied at neck. Reverse: TYPOY IEPAΣ [KAI AΣYΛOY], eagle standing left on prow, palm on far wing; in left field, date (ΓM) and club; in right field, Δ; between eagle's legs, 'aleph'. Hendin 1619; DCA Suppl. 483. Untoned. Extremely Fine / Choice Very Fine. Estimated Value $400 - UP
Ex Kenneth Brattlie Collection, from Warden Numismaticss NYINC 2006 bourse.
